Patent number: 10060665Abstract: The invention is an improved ice handling container and methods for using the container. The container includes a bottom wall with upstanding sidewalls terminating in a mouth. A bail having an apex and opposing ends is pivotally attached to opposing sidewalls of the container. The bail has a handle generally at the apex and a hook extending generally outwardly from the bail generally near the apex of the bail for hanging the container with the mouth facing generally upward. One sidewall has a handle generally adjacent the bottom wall and a hook generally adjacent the handle extending generally outwardly and upwardly from the sidewall for hanging the container with the mouth facing generally downward.Type: GrantFiled: May 11, 2017Date of Patent: August 28, 2018Assignee: Ecolab USA Inc.Inventors: Brian Philip Carlson, Ryan A. Patent number: 8839550Abstract: A rodent station for capturing or trapping mice, rats or other rodents may provide one or more rodent entry points and is sized to receive one or more rodent suppression devices, such as conventional snap traps, ramp traps, glue boards, etc. The rodent station may present a high contrast entrance that is relatively darker than the station enclosure. The station opening size may be adjustable to accommodate both mice and/or rats. An interior receptacle for station maintenance records or other printed material may also be included.Type: GrantFiled: January 7, 2011Date of Patent: September 23, 2014Assignee: Ecolab USA Inc.Inventors: Douglas B. Patent number: 8815171Abstract: A cast solid product dispenser for controlling the inputs and operating parameters of dissolution of a cast solid product is disclosed. The dispenser (10) includes a housing (12) having a cavity (18) for removably receiving a container (14) holding a cast solid product. The dispenser (10) includes means for controlling the temperature and pressure of liquid used for dissolution of the cast solid product. The dispenser (10) also includes a pedestal (20) for maintaining a constant distance between the surface of the product and a nozzle (48) during dissolution. The dissolution cycle includes a pulse of spray generally followed by a delay to allow liquid used in the dissolution process to adjust to a desired temperature. A pressure regulator (42) adjusts the pressure variation between various liquid sources so both the pressure and temperature of liquid used in the dissolution process is generally constant.Type: GrantFiled: September 9, 2011Date of Patent: August 26, 2014Assignee: Ecolab USA Inc.Inventor: Christopher C.
